Elba lost against Heartland Lutheran back in January and unfortunately they wound up with the same result on Tuesday. The Elba Bluejays took a blow against the Heartland Lutheran Red Hornets, falling 61-21. The Bluejays were in a tough position after the first half, with the score already sitting at 33-13.

Despite the loss, Elba had strong showings from Blake Barg, who posted ten points and eight rebounds, and Ethan Lange, who had four points. Barg is on a roll when it comes to boards, as he's now pulled down eight or more in the last three games he's played.
Heartland Lutheran's success was the result of a balanced attack that saw several players step up, but Chad Rostvet led the charge by dropping a double-double on 15 points and 12 rebounds. The dominant performance also gave Rostvet a new career-high in steals (six). Another player making a difference was Cole Lindner, who went 7 of 12 en route to 16 points and five steals.
Elba has been struggling recently as they've lost nine of their last ten matches, which put a noticeable dent in their 2-16 record this season. As for Heartland Lutheran, their win ended a four-game drought on the road and puts them at 5-13.
Both teams are looking forward to the support of their home crowds in their upcoming games. Elba will welcome Twin Loup at 7:00 p.m. on Friday. As for Heartland Lutheran, they will host Palmer at 7:30 p.m. on Thursday.
